External indicator for electronic toll communications

Abstract
An external indicator for use in proximity to an on-board unit or transponder for an electronic toll collection (ETC) system. The external indicator senses RF transmissions from the on-board unit and/or roadside readers of the ETC system and produces sensory outputs when transmissions are detected. The external indicator receives RF signals, demodulates them, and analyses the demodulated RF signals to determine if it has received a roadside reader trigger signal and/or a transponder response signal. A sensory indicator, such as a visual, auditory, or kinetic device, alerts an occupant of a vehicle to the detected RF transmissions and, accordingly, to the likely occurrence of an ETC transaction.

12. A method of signalling detection of a likely electronic toll collection (ETC) transaction between an on-board unit and a roadside unit, the method comprising the steps of:
-
receiving and demodulating an RF signal to produce a demodulated signal;
determining if the demodulated signal is indicative of an ETC communication between the roadside unit and the on-board unit and, if so, generating an indicator signal; and
